IBM Support

RS00121: REMOTE JMX INTERACTION WITH RES MANAGEMENT MBEANS MAY FAIL

Subscribe

You can track all active APARs for this component.

 

APAR status

  • Closed as documentation error.

Error description

  • When a client tries to interact remotely with RES management
    MBeans it may fail with the following error:
    
    [2/12/10 16:10:19:703 PST] 00000026 SystemOut O 2137282
    [SoapConnectorThreadPool : 0] ERROR
    ilog.rules.res.model.mbean.IlrJMXRuleAppMBean - Register MBean
    failed with type "IlrJMXRuleApp", properties
    "{Name=JmxRemoteSample, Version=1.0}", and for the object
    ilog.rules.res.model.mbean.websphere.IlrJMXRuleApp@77e577e5.
    com.ibm.websphere.management.exception.AdminException:
    ADMN0005E: The service is unable to activate MBean: type
    IlrJMXRuleApp, collaborator
    ilog.rules.res.model.mbean.websphere.IlrJMXRuleApp@77e577e5,
    configuration ID
    ilog.rules.res.model.mbean.websphere.IlrJMXRuleApp, descriptor
    IlrJMXRuleApp.xml.
    at
    com.ibm.ws.management.MBeanFactoryImpl.activateMBean(MBeanFactor
    yImpl.java:717)
    [...]
    at com.ibm.ws.util.ThreadPool$Worker.run(ThreadPool.java:1550)
    Caused by:
    com.ibm.websphere.management.exception.DescriptorParseException:
    ADMN0001W: The service is unable to parse the MBean descriptor
    file IlrJMXRuleApp.xml.
    at
    com.ibm.ws.management.descriptor.MBeanDescriptorManager.loadDesc
    riptorFile(MBeanDescriptorManager.java:409)
    at
    com.ibm.ws.management.descriptor.MBeanDescriptorManager.getDescr
    iptor(MBeanDescriptorManager.java:188)
    at
    com.ibm.ws.management.MBeanFactoryImpl.activateMBean(MBeanFactor
    yImpl.java:429)
    ... 40 more
    Caused by:
    java.io.FileNotFoundException: IlrJMXRuleApp.xml
    ... 43 more
    

Local fix

  • - Package in a new jar the following XML files from
    jrules-res-management-<APPSERVER>.ear/jrules-res-management.war/
    WEB-INF/lib/res-model-mbean-<VERSION>.jar :
    
    IlrJMXRepository.xml
    IlrJMXRepositorySecurity.xml
    IlrJMXRuleApp.xml
    IlrJMXRuleAppSecurity.xml
    IlrJMXRuleset.xml
    IlrJMXRulesetSecurity.xml
    
    - Put the new jar on the System classpath of the Application
    server hosting the RES console ( e.g. by adding to the CLASSPATH
    of the server JVM process)
    

Problem summary

  •  When a client tries to interact remotely with RES management
    MBeans it may fail with the following error:
    

Problem conclusion

  • The documentation of the WebSphere installation guide has been
    amended in the section related to the RES Console deployment
    

Temporary fix

Comments

APAR Information

  • APAR number

    RS00121

  • Reported component name

    WS ILOG JRULES

  • Reported component ID

    5724X9800

  • Reported release

    700

  • Status

    CLOSED DOC

  • PE

    NoPE

  • HIPER

    NoHIPER

  • Special Attention

    NoSpecatt

  • Submitted date

    2010-02-15

  • Closed date

    2010-05-31

  • Last modified date

    2010-05-31

  • APAR is sysrouted FROM one or more of the following:

  • APAR is sysrouted TO one or more of the following:

Fix information

Applicable component levels

[{"Business Unit":{"code":"BU053","label":"Cloud & Data Platform"},"Product":{"code":"SS6MTS","label":"WebSphere ILOG JRules"},"Component":"","ARM Category":[],"Platform":[{"code":"PF025","label":"Platform Independent"}],"Version":"7.0","Edition":"","Line of Business":{"code":"LOB45","label":"Automation"}}]

Document Information

Modified date:
31 May 2010